As January 1 looms in the very near future, everyone is talking about change and transformation. Let's talk about why change feels so difficult, the brain's preference for familiarity, and how both scripture and science support the idea of transformation as a gradual process. We'll also touch on the significance of identity in driving long-term change and the spiritual and scientific perspectives on rest and mindfulness.
Key Scriptures:
Romans 12:2 — “Be transformed by the renewing of your mind.”
2 Corinthians 5:17 — “If anyone is in Christ, he is a new creation.”
Philippians 1:6 — “He who began a good work in you will carry it on to completion.”
Scientific References:
Lally, P. et al. (University College London, 2009). Habit Formation Study — average 66 days to form a new habit.
Fogg, B. J. (Stanford University). Tiny Habits Research — small consistent actions create sustainable change.
Doidge, N. (2007). The Brain That Changes Itself — foundational work on neuroplasticity.

What is the importance of slowing down in a fast-paced world, especially for mothers? We need to remember that rest is not a luxury but a necessity for spiritual and emotional well-being. Let's look at both the scientific benefits of slowing down and the spiritual significance of rest as modeled by Jesus.
Key Scriptures:
Mark 6:31 — “Come with me by yourselves to a quiet place and get some rest.”
Luke 5:16 — Jesus withdrew often to pray.
Genesis 2:2 — God rested on the seventh day.
Psalm 46:10 — “Be still, and know that I am God.”
Scientific References:
Benson, H. et al. (Harvard Medical School). Relaxation Response Study — prayer and breathing alter stress-related gene expression.
Davidson, R. J. (University of Wisconsin) — mindfulness and stress resilience research.
McEwen, B. (2007). Physiology & Behavior — effects of chronic stress on neurobiology.

Today we delve into the profound topic of forgiveness, exploring its significance in emotional healing and personal freedom. Forgiveness is not about excusing wrongs but about releasing the emotional burdens that weigh us down. Using a basis of both science and Scripture, forgiveness can lead to improved mental health and emotional regulation. The conversation also touches on the importance of practicing compassion, both towards others and oneself, as a crucial step in the forgiveness process. Join me as we embrace forgiveness as a pathway to peace and spiritual growth.
Key Scriptures:
Matthew 6:14–15 — Forgive others, as your Father forgives you.
Ephesians 4:31–32 — Be kind and compassionate, forgiving as Christ forgave you.
2 Corinthians 5:17 — “The old has gone, the new is here.”
Scientific References:
Stanford Forgiveness Project (Luskin, F.) — “Forgive for Good” research findings on health and emotional well-being.
Worthington, E. L. (2019). Forgiveness and Reconciliation: Theory and Application.
Davidson, R. J. (2003). Studies on compassion meditation and the prefrontal cortex.

Everyone talks gratitude into the ground this season...but what if it's more than just saying "thanks"? This week, we dive into gratitude as a practice, how to make it deeper (in just a few extra seconds!), and how gratitude is hard wired into our brains to make us happier.
Key Scriptures:
1 Thessalonians 5:18 — “Give thanks in all circumstances; for this is God’s will for you in Christ Jesus.”
Psalm 100:4 — “Enter his gates with thanksgiving and his courts with praise; give thanks to him and praise his name.”
Philippians 4:6–7 — “Do not be anxious about anything, but in everything by prayer and petition, with thanksgiving, present your requests to God…”
Scientific References:
Emmons, R.A., & McCullough, M.E. (2003). Counting blessings versus burdens: An experimental investigation of gratitude and subjective well-being in daily life. Journal of Personality and Social Psychology, 84(2), 377–389.
University of California, Berkeley Greater Good Science Center: The Science of Gratitude (2018).
